条件度量的DAX语法是一种用于格式化矩阵的列值的语法。DAX(Data Analysis Expressions)是一种用于计算和处理数据的函数语言,特别适用于Power BI和Excel中的数据分析。它提供了丰富的功能来定义和操作数据模型中的度量。
在DAX中,条件度量通过使用IF函数来实现。IF函数根据给定的条件,返回不同的结果。它的语法如下:
IF(<condition>, <true_result>, <false_result>)
其中,<condition>是一个逻辑表达式,用于判断某个条件是否为真。如果条件为真,则返回<true_result>,否则返回<false_result>。
当要根据列的值格式化矩阵时,可以在DAX语句中使用条件度量来定义特定的格式。例如,假设有一个名为"Sales"的度量,表示销售额。我们可以使用条件度量来根据销售额的大小,对矩阵中的值进行格式化,如下所示:
Sales_Format := IF([Sales] < 1000, "Low", IF([Sales] < 5000, "Medium", "High"))
上述DAX语句中,如果销售额小于1000,则将格式设置为"Low";如果销售额介于1000和5000之间,则设置为"Medium";否则设置为"High"。
通过使用条件度量的DAX语法,我们可以根据列的值的不同情况,对矩阵进行灵活的格式化,从而更好地呈现和分析数据。
腾讯云提供了一系列与数据分析和云计算相关的产品和服务,如云数据库 TencentDB、云函数 SCF、云存储 COS等,这些产品可以与DAX语法结合使用,为用户提供强大的数据分析和处理能力。您可以访问腾讯云官网(https://cloud.tencent.com/)了解更多关于这些产品的详细信息。
领取专属 10元无门槛券
手把手带您无忧上云